From Nashville to Nonprofits: Taylor’s Charitable Journey
Taylor Swift’s generosity dates back to the early 2010s, a period when she first began making headlines not only for her songwriting prowess but also for her philanthropic spirit. Whether it’s donating millions to disaster relief efforts or supporting education initiatives, Taylor has consistently demonstrated a deep commitment to giving back.
One memorable moment was her $1 million donation to Louisiana flood relief in 2016. When disaster struck, Taylor acted fast, showing fans and the public that she’s not just an artist who sings about heartbreak—she stands with communities in their hardest moments. Over the years, she has continued to respond to natural disasters with both financial support and awareness campaigns.
Championing Education and Empowering Youth
Taylor’s passion for education is another pillar of her philanthropy. She has donated to various educational programs, from funding literacy projects to providing scholarships for underprivileged students. In 2019, Taylor gifted $113,000 to the Country Music Hall of Fame’s education center, highlighting her ongoing dedication to music education and youth empowerment.
Moreover, she’s used her platform to encourage young people to vote—a vital move considering the influence that youth turnout can have on elections. Taylor’s 2018 Instagram post urging fans to register to vote sparked a wave of awareness and action, positioning her as a key influencer in the voter registration movement, particularly for millennials and Gen Z.
A Bold Advocate for LGBTQ+ Rights
Perhaps one of the most compelling aspects of Taylor Swift’s activism is her outspoken support for LGBTQ+ rights. Earlier in her career, Taylor was more reserved publicly, but from 2019 onward, especially with the release of “You Need To Calm Down,” she’s made it clear that equality and inclusivity are non-negotiable.
She’s raised funds and participated in campaigns championing LGBTQ+ causes, including advocating for the Equality Act in the United States. Her advocacy goes beyond statements, embedding herself as an ally who highlights the importance of safe spaces, pride, and legal protections for LGBTQ+ individuals.
